Identifying and Amendment Techniques

Effective diagnosis is paramount for rapidly addressing any problems that may arise with your system/device/equipment. This process typically involves a systematic strategy to identify the root cause of the issue and implement effective repairs. A common flow in troubleshooting includes visually inspecting for website any obvious damage, checking links for security, and testing components with appropriate instruments. Once the source of the malfunction has been pinpointed, you can then apply the necessary repairs. This may require replacing faulty elements, calibrating settings, or even reconfiguring software.

In conclusion, successful problem-solving and fixation often requires a combination of technical expertise, analytical skills, and patience. Remember to always consult the applicable manuals for your specific system/device/equipment before attempting any repairs.

Thorough Component Specifications and Diagrams

Delivering efficient product development hinges on providing precise component specifications and diagrams. These documents act as the foundation for manufacturing, assembly, and maintenance. A in-depth set of specifications should detail every aspect of a component, including its dimensions, materials, tolerances, functions, and interconnections with other components.

Diagrams play a crucial role in communicating the physical arrangement of components within a system. Types of diagrams can differ from simple representations to complex blueprints, each serving unique purposes in conveying information about configuration.

  • Accurate component specifications and diagrams ensure proper communication among engineers, designers, manufacturers, and technicians.
  • Well-defined specifications minimize ambiguity and the potential for errors during production.
  • Diagrams aid understanding of complex systems, making it easier to identify potential issues and optimize performance.
